India should respond firmly: Abhishek Banerjee over Trump's 50% tariffs

Calling it a "diplomatic failure", Trinamool Congress MP Abhishek Banerjee on Thursday launched a scathing attack on the Centre over the imposition of 50% tariffs on Indian goods by US President Donald Trump.

He also suggested that India should respond to this firmly. Banerjee strongly condemned Trump's observations about the Indian economy.

"Trump said that India's economy is dead. I do not agree. No one has the power to kill the Indian economy surviving on the love and affection of 140 crore Indians. I can say that the Indian economy is in the ICU. From bad, it has become worse in the last 10 years. By imposing a 50% tariff, there will be substantial job loss. Exports will be down. This is the result of the poor foreign policy of the Indian government," he said.
